diff options
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 52 |
1 files changed, 23 insertions, 29 deletions
diff --git a/configure.ac b/configure.ac index 5393100..e6051ca 100644 --- a/configure.ac +++ b/configure.ac @@ -65,6 +65,28 @@ PKG_CHECK_MODULES([LIBXML],[ libxml-2.0 ]) +# ===== +# Tools +# ===== +AC_ARG_ENABLE([tools], + [AS_HELP_STRING([--disable-tools], [Build conversion tools])], + [enable_tools="$enableval"], + [enable_tools=yes] +) +AS_IF([test "x$enable_tools" = "xyes"], [ + PKG_CHECK_MODULES([REVENGE_GENERATORS],[ + librevenge-generators-0.0 + ]) + PKG_CHECK_MODULES([REVENGE_STREAM],[ + librevenge-stream-0.0 + ]) +]) +AC_SUBST([REVENGE_GENERATORS_CFLAGS]) +AC_SUBST([REVENGE_GENERATORS_LIBS]) +AC_SUBST([REVENGE_STREAM_CFLAGS]) +AC_SUBST([REVENGE_STREAM_LIBS]) +AM_CONDITIONAL(BUILD_TOOLS, [test "x$enable_tools" = "xyes"]) + # ================================= # Libtool/Version Makefile settings # ================================= @@ -202,21 +224,6 @@ AS_IF([test "x$enable_debug" = "xyes"], [ ]) AC_SUBST(DEBUG_CXXFLAGS) -# ============ -# Static tools -# ============ -AC_ARG_ENABLE([static-tools], - [AS_HELP_STRING([--enable-static-tools], [Link tools (binaries) statically])], - [enable_static_tools="$enableval"], - [enable_static_tools=no] -) -AS_IF([test "x$enable_static_tools" = "xyes"], [ - enable_static="yes" -], [ - AC_DISABLE_STATIC -]) -AM_CONDITIONAL(STATIC_TOOLS, [test "x$enable_static_tools" = "xyes"]) - # ============= # Documentation # ============= @@ -235,17 +242,6 @@ AS_IF([test "x$with_docs" != "xno"], [ ], [build_docs=no]) AM_CONDITIONAL([WITH_LIBPICT_DOCS], [test "x$build_docs" != "xno"]) -PKG_CHECK_MODULES([REVENGE_GENERATORS],[ - librevenge-generators-0.0 -]) -PKG_CHECK_MODULES([REVENGE_STREAM],[ - librevenge-stream-0.0 -]) -AC_SUBST([REVENGE_GENERATORS_CFLAGS]) -AC_SUBST([REVENGE_GENERATORS_LIBS]) -AC_SUBST([REVENGE_STREAM_CFLAGS]) -AC_SUBST([REVENGE_STREAM_LIBS]) - # ===================== # Prepare all .in files # ===================== @@ -266,8 +262,6 @@ build/win32/Makefile docs/Makefile docs/doxygen/Makefile libpict-$PICT_MAJOR_VERSION.$PICT_MINOR_VERSION.pc:libpict.pc.in -libpict.spec -libpict-zip ]) AC_OUTPUT @@ -279,7 +273,7 @@ AC_MSG_NOTICE([ Build configuration: debug: ${enable_debug} docs: ${build_docs} - static-tools: ${enable_static_tools} + tools: ${enable_tools} werror: ${enable_werror} ============================================================================== ]) |